How everything started

The idea for The SOULMATES popped up after a gig with Richard Broadnax towards the end ot the gospel season 2005. Manuela mentioned that she would like the season to go on. The choir was so well in form. Sonja took up the idea and proposed to create a new vocal funk and soul band. Both Cherry and Freddy liked the idea.

The main purpose of the band would be to enjoy singing funky soulmusic together. On the same evening Sonja asked Greg if he was interested to join The SOULMATES as keyboarder and singer. And in the backhand she had already Jean-Marc (guitar) and Chris (bass), friends since over 20 years and part of the rhythm section of SPLIT. Only a short time ago they had started to play with Haig (drums). So The SOULMATES were complete for a start.

Now we began to manifest our dreams. Step by step. Motivated by the joy of it. In April 2006 we met each other for a first audition. And it was promising. And most importantantly: we felt good vibes among ourselves! Finally The SOULMATES were born.

We started to build a repertoire. And we did that in the living room of Sonja and Jean-Marc. For those of you who would like to get an idea we have added a few MP3's from our first rehearsal. Since then we rehearse and prepare.

In November the saxophone player Florian Egli has joind our band. Program and repertoire for our first concerts were built.

The Premiere of The SOULMATES takes place on Thuesday May 22, 2007 in the Jazz-Club Moods, Zurich, Switzerland. Already confirmed are further concerts, on Friday June 15, 2007 in SCALA, Wetzikon and on Friday August 31, 2007, in the Jazz-Club Bülach.
